Every year, the Swedish Social Insurance Agency makes 21 million decisions that affect people's lives and society as a whole. We distribute approximately 260 billion kronor annually. These are taxpayer funds in our care. It is a great responsibility. That is why we examine each case carefully, follow laws and regulations, inform and guide, care, and show consideration. Close leadership, change, sustainable workplace
As a unit manager, you are the manager closest to your employees and operations. You are responsible for leading and driving daily work based on the department's mission and goals, where public service values permeate your work. Through your leadership, you communicate clear expectations, follow up on goals, and provide your employees with the right conditions to take responsibility. You have personnel responsibility as well as results and follow-up responsibility for the teams in your unit.
Your unit consists of approximately 20 employees who work with investigating the right to assistance compensation and are located in Stockholm, Eskilstuna, Nyköping, and Uppsala. Through close leadership, you create the predictability, security, and sustainability necessary for employees to take responsibility and meet the need for change. You create understanding of context, direction, and the goals set by the department, and you develop the plans your operations need. As a unit manager, you support the area manager and participate in the area's management group consisting of 8 unit managers, where you contribute your expertise and commitment. You adapt and exercise your leadership in a way that enables employees to use their judgment and competence.
The position involves handling classified information, which places high demands on proper handling. Therefore, it is important that you have a high level of security awareness.
